This title was first published in 2000: The book analyses the
development of arctic environmental cooperation since the late
1980s until the establishment of the Arctic Council in 1996. The
study is based on the discourse analysis of statement, documents
and interviews by the different actors in the cooperation. In this
book, the problem of the environment is seen as a problem of order:
it is a problem of ordering relations among related actors, of
ordering priorities of action and of ordering relations between
different institutional arrangements locally, regionally and
internally. Three discourses were found in the cooperation:
discourses of sovereignty, knowledge and development. In the
discourse of sovereignty, the development of relations between
state and indigenous peoples in terms of international
environmental cooperation is central. In the discourse of
knowledge, the different forms of knowledge and the role of
different producers of knowledge in cooperation has been discussed.
The discourse of development focuses on the idea of sustainable
development and its applications in defining the future of the
Circumpolar North and the activities of the Arctic Council. The
arctic cooperation can be understood as a regional effort to make
an order of sustainability into practice.
